Barbed wire fence installation services involve setting up durable fencing systems primarily composed of twisted steel wire with sharp barbs spaced at intervals. These services typically include planning the layout, preparing the land, installing fence posts, and attaching the barbed wire securely to create a sturdy barrier. Professional installers ensure that the wire is tensioned correctly and that the fencing is anchored properly to withstand environmental conditions and prevent unauthorized entry. The process often requires specialized equipment and knowledge to achieve a long-lasting, effective fence.

This type of fencing is frequently used to address security concerns, property boundaries, and livestock containment. Barbed wire fences serve as an effective deterrent against trespassers and intruders, making them popular for rural properties, farms, and ranches. They also help prevent animals from wandering off or onto neighboring properties, providing a clear demarcation line. Additionally, barbed wire fences can be useful in industrial or commercial areas where a high level of perimeter security is necessary.

Properties that typically utilize barbed wire fencing include agricultural lands, large estates, and industrial sites. Farms and ranches often rely on these fences to contain livestock and protect crops from wildlife or trespassers. Commercial properties and construction sites may install barbed wire fences to secure equipment and materials, while rural residential properties might use them to establish clear boundaries and enhance security. The fencing can be adapted to various terrains and property sizes, making it a versatile option for many property types.

The overview below groups typical Barbed Wire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Whatcom County,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of barbed wire materials typically ranges from $0.50 to $1.50 per linear foot, depending on the gauge and quality. For a standard 200-foot fence, material expenses can vary between $100 and $300.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project requirements.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$1.00 and $3.00 per foot, influenced by terrain and accessibility. For a typical fencing project, total labor charges might range from $200 to $600. Prices vary by region and contractor experience.

Additional Equipment - Equipment rental or purchase, such as post drivers or tensioners, can add approximately $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These tools are essential for proper installation and may be included in the contractor’s fee or charged separately.

Project Size & Complexity - Larger or more complex fencing projects tend to increase costs proportionally, with some installations reaching $2,000 or more. Factors like terrain, gates, and terrain obstacles influence the final price, which local service providers can help estimate.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a barbed wire fence? A barbed wire fence can provide effective security and containment for livestock or property boundaries, helping to deter intruders and prevent animals from escaping.

How long does a typical barbed wire fence installation take? The installation duration varies based on the size and compl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ates during consultation.

What factors should be considered before installing a barbed wire fence? Important considerations include property layout, intended use, local regulations, and the type of terrain where the fence will be installed.

Can a barbed wire fence be installed on existing structures? Yes, in some cases, barbed wire can be added to existing fences or structures, but a professional assessment is recommended to ensure proper installation.

What maintenance is required for a barbed wire fence? Regular inspections for rust, loose wires, or damage are recommended; repairs should be performed promptly to maintain fence integrity.
